Understanding Ripple and XRP

Ripple is a peer-to-peer payment network that leverages blockchain technology to facilitate faster and more scalable transactions. The native cryptocurrency, XRP, enables users to transact directly on the network without the need for intermediaries such as banks. This makes it particularly appealing for businesses and consumers who are seeking to expedite cross-border remittances.

Analyzing Market Trends and Volatility

The cryptocurrency market is notorious for its volatility, and Ripple is no exception. XRP, like other cryptocurrencies, can experience significant price fluctuations. To avoid substantial losses, it is crucial to conduct thorough research and stay informed about market trends. Understanding the factors that influence the price of XRP, such as regulatory changes, partnership developments, and economic conditions, can help you make more informed decisions.

Regulatory Environment and Compliance

One of the most critical factors to consider when investing in Ripple is the regulatory landscape. Ripple has made significant efforts to ensure full compliance with anti-money laundering and know-your-customer (KYC) regulations. They have collaborated closely with regulatory bodies to establish a framework that aligns with global standards. However, the regulatory environment is continuously evolving, and it is essential to stay vigilant as more governments and regulatory bodies adopt positions on how cryptocurrencies are handled.
